Description

Your students will love these 32 subject verb agreement task cards!

Use these 32 multiple choice task cards to help your students gain fluency with subject-verb agreement. On half the cards the students must select the correct verb and on the other half they must select the correct noun. Tricky words such as everyone, no one, and anyone are included, as well as a few irregular verbs. These task cards are perfect for test prep and will work well at literacy centers, at stations, for partner work, or with the whole class using a game like Scoot.

Contents of this set include:

  • Directions and Suggestions
  • 32 Task Cards - Color
  • 32 Task Cards - Black and White
  • Google Slides Activity
  • Easel Assessment
  • Challenge Card and Cover Card
  • Student Answer Sheets
  • Answer Key

An answer sheet for students to record their answers is included, along with an answer key for self-checking. You will also find a Cover Card for the set, and a Challenge Card that asks students to tell whether the subject on each card is singular or plural.

Print this set out in color. For black and white printing, please use the included black line version. If you are printing in black and white, consider printing on colored paper. Simply print and cut along the guidelines. Laminate and use them again and again. Alternatively, you could print on cardstock. It works well to keep them in a baggie. Another option is to hole-punch a corner of each card and put them all on a ring.
